Basic Concepts of a Fan Hub

A fan hub is a central part of the engine cooling system. Its primary function is to control the operation of the cooling fan, ensuring that airflow is managed effectively to dissipate heat from the engine. The fan hub operates by engaging and disengaging the fan based on the engine’s temperature needs, thus optimizing cooling efficiency and reducing unnecessary fuel consumption 1.

Fan Hub Part 3878739 Compatibility with Cummins Engines

The Fan Hub part 3878739, manufactured by Cummins, is designed to integrate seamlessly with specific engine models. This part is crucial for the proper functioning of the engine’s cooling system, ensuring efficient heat dissipation and maintaining optimal engine performance.

N14 G and N14 MECHANICAL Engines

The Fan Hub part 3878739 is compatible with both the N14 G and N14 MECHANICAL engines. These engines are known for their robust design and reliability, often used in heavy-duty applications. The Fan Hub part is engineered to fit precisely within these engines, providing a secure and efficient connection to the fan assembly. This ensures that the fan operates smoothly, enhancing the engine’s cooling efficiency.

Understanding the Role of Part 3878739 Fan Hub in Engine Systems

The part 3878739 Fan Hub is an integral component in the operation of engine systems, specifically in relation to the engine fan and fan drive. This component facilitates the efficient transfer of rotational force from the fan drive to the engine fan, ensuring optimal cooling performance for the engine.

Interaction with the Engine Fan

The engine fan, a pivotal part of the cooling system, relies on the fan hub to maintain its rotational stability and alignment. As the fan hub connects the fan blades to the fan drive, it ensures that the fan operates smoothly and effectively. This connection is essential for dissipating heat away from the engine, particularly under high-load conditions or when the vehicle is stationary.

Coordination with the Fan Drive

The fan drive, which can be either mechanical or electric, works in conjunction with the fan hub to regulate the speed of the engine fan. The fan hub’s design allows for variable fan speeds, which are crucial for maintaining the right balance between cooling efficiency and engine performance. By modulating the fan speed according to the engine’s thermal needs, the fan hub helps in reducing unnecessary drag on the engine, thereby improving fuel efficiency and overall engine health 3.
